Heiner Lobenberg om:
Chateau Canon 1er Grand Cru Classe B 2021

97–99+
/100

2021 Canon består af 71 procent Merlot og 29 procent Cabernet Franc, 13,5 procent alkohol i volumen. Der var meget lidt frost her, ingen udbyttetab. 50 procent nyt træ. Ren, gennemsigtig elegance i næsen. Merlot-frugten skinner utroligt meget her. Meget ædle, sublime sorte kirsebærsmage ledsaget af æterisk friskhed. Masser af mynte. Gribende frugt i munden. Wow, så meget tryk fra denne klare røde frugt. Vilde jordbær, hindbær, strålende friskhed af tranebær. Meget præcis. Kalk-mineral accentueret. Masser af kraft fra den salte kalkstensmineralitet. Den er ekstremt finpoleret og elegant. Slutter med en lang finish med modne morbær og ribs. Masser af kraft, men ingen stor damphammer, der altid forbliver på den elegante, svævende åre. Meget fint ciseleret og klar. 97-99+/100 *** Hos Canon ligger 80 procent af vinmarkerne på ren kalksten på plateauet - den bedste beliggenhed i Saint-Émilion. 20 procent på plateauets sydlige skråninger med lidt mere ler og sand. Canon tilhører de samme ejere som Rauzan-Ségla. I årevis har dette været meget mere end et insidertip i Saint-Émilion. Faktisk en af de mest eftertragtede superstjerner. Bliver snart en 1er Grand Cru Classe A. Virkelig svær at få fat i. *** Som i de fleste regioner i Europa er tendensen i Bordeaux "2021 - tilbage til klassikerne!". Efter flere varme år i træk kommer 2021 rundt om hjørnet her med genial kølig elegance og lave alkoholniveauer. Meget elegant, fin, men også fuld af spænding - et absolut drømmeår for finessedrikkere. Vinene viser en masse aromatisk frugtudtryk med en virkelig moden tanninstruktur takket være den længere vækstsæson. Et stort lettelsens suk blandt alle vinbønder, da resultatet er en slags kompensation for det hårde arbejde i vinmarken, som naturen krævede af alle involverede fra begyndelsen til slutningen af året. Meget nedbør i begyndelsen af året, hvilket også var en velsignelse for de tørre jorde. Derefter endnu en lav temperatur i april, lige efter knopskydningen. Bordelais blev dog ikke ramt helt så hårdt, frostskaderne her var ikke så ødelæggende i gennemsnit som i andre dele af Frankrig, og derfor er udbyttet stadig tilfredsstillende generelt. Merlot'en er usædvanlig ædel med bemærkelsesværdig koncentreret frugt, mens Cabernet'en er utrolig intens og frisk, hvilket giver årgangen stor elegance. Måske på linje med 2008, 2012 og 2014 med deres vine, som allerede er så forførende tilgængelige som unge, men som også har en lang fremtid foran sig.

Galloni om: Chateau Canon 1er Grand Cru Classe B

The 2021 Canon shows just how magical this site is. Vertical and explosive in feel, with tons of pure power, it impresses with its intensity, drive and super-classic profile. Bright saline notes and vibrant tannins give the 2021 a feeling of energy that only gains momentum with time in the glass. It's not an easy Canon, like the 2015 or 2018, but it is incredibly expressive. It is the sort of wine that only truly emerges with time in bottle. I would be thrilled to own it. Canon must surely be one of the great relative values in first-class wine. Wow. Tasted two times. 97/100

Jane Anson om: Chateau Canon 1er Grand Cru Classe B

Gorgeous bright plum colour with violet reflections. The epitome of careful, precise, well-spliced winemaking. Sibling estate Berliquet has perhaps more immediate charm, because there is more power running through it, but this is just elegance and finesse personified. Red cherry, raspberry, blueberry, blackberry, slate, saffron, oyster shell, they have teased out layers of complexity that were not easy to find in the vintage, and there is length also, with pummice stone salinity scraping across the palate. It's subtle, and it's not at the heights of a 2019 Canon, but this will not be out of place in a vertical of the estate. Tasted twice. 50% new oak, 40hl/h yield, harvest September 16 to October 8. Thomas Duclos consultant. 96/100

Parker om: Chateau Canon 1er Grand Cru Classe B

A brilliant wine in the making, the 2021 Canon offers up aromas of cherries, wild berries, licorice, sweet soil tones, raw cocoa, Indian spices and rose petals. Medium to full-bodied, layered and multidimensional, it's immensely refined and seamless, with a lively spine of acidity, ripe tannins and a long, penetrating, intensely saline finish. This beautifully balanced Canon is one of the classiest, most complete wines of the Right Bank in this vintage. Tasted four times. 94-96/100

Jeff Leve om: Chateau Canon 1er Grand Cru Classe B

The nose stands out with its nuances of flowers, crushed stones, spearmint, cigar wrapper, red plums, fresh cherries, herbs, and a touch of fennel. The wine is all about its freshness, purity, energy, and elegant nature, finishing with silky tannins with their trademark touch of salt, mint leaf, and sweet, vibrant red berries. The wine blends 71% Merlot with 29% Cabernet Franc, 13.5% ABV. The harvest took place September 16 – October 6. Drink from 2026-2055. 94-96/100

Min vinmager

Chateau Canon

Vinmarkerne på Chateau Canon ligger på plateauet i Saint Emilion med ler og dyb kalksten. Den udsatte syd/sydvest-eksponering giver druerne et betydeligt højere antal solskinstimer, hvilket resulterer i en bedre modning af druerne.
